Output 507732f1f8e69207e4a01b8f747a705de83b45b38cb33068991979faa9585f24:126

value
17536466
script pubkey
OP_0 OP_PUSHBYTES_32 abe85c03500237e03e8aee7e5f7387b82149be4dc3285864f45dd9cc661e7e77
address
ltc1q4059cq6sqgm7q052ael97uu8hqs5n0jdcv59se85thvuces70ems7n2e32
transaction
507732f1f8e69207e4a01b8f747a705de83b45b38cb33068991979faa9585f24
spent
true